Output 29f5d5b5642e32bf88fb9637e70c06e26d40ccad0ca7bbf5e32ecc4150d43bcd:20

value
3633656719
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16afb587f2d3a6c679aba792899184cf2adf4b58 OP_EQUALVERIFY OP_CHECKSIG
address
134xMhmkrEXYxuzs84E5dnQqJUKQV8c5iH
transaction
29f5d5b5642e32bf88fb9637e70c06e26d40ccad0ca7bbf5e32ecc4150d43bcd
spent
true